Education

Want to get smarter? Run more. At least, that's what recent studies have found. Running stimulates the brain to grow new neurons / grey matter in the hippocampus. This is the part of the brain used for contextual memories (both in time and space), and is critical for "fluid intelligence" (our ability to reason and problem-solve). In fact, going for an AM run improves blood flow to the brain, as well as relieve stress and anxiety... a good way to start any test. That and sleeping, breathing, meditating, eating complex carbohydrates, and laying off the drugs also help.

Don't fret if you're injured and can't run. Any form of aerobic exercise improves intelligence (so long as you're not studying while you doing it... dang it... the only way I could stay awake while reading text books was on an exercise bike). Yoga also has beneficial effects, although weight lifting doesn't.
